Mainly what I want is to provide a tool that allows the community to prop those who are providing value to the board and downgrade those who are bringing it down. Maybe this would be good, maybe not... worth trying it out I think. I'm looking at it, but basically there are lots of variables with it. A new poster could not come in and give you a big ding on your rep. To give you an idea, here are some of the settings you could do with it. The red text value is the default recommendation: Default Reputation (10) What reputation level shall new users receive upon registration? Number of Reputation Ratings to Display (5) How many ratings to display in the user's control panel. Register Date Factor (365) For every X number of days, users gain 1 point of reputation-altering power. Post Count Factor (1000) For every X number of posts, users gain 1 point of reputation-altering power. Reputation Point Factor (100) For every X points of reputation, users gain 1 point of reputation-altering power. Minimum Post Count (50) How many posts must a user have before his reputation hits count on others? Minimum Reputation Count (10) How much reputation must a user have before his reputation hits count on others? Daily Reputation Clicks Limit (10) How many reputation clicks can a user give over each 24 hour period? Reputation User Spread (20) How many different users must you give reputation to before you can hit the same person again?
